I think one can be done with x86 AES and SHA instructions provided there a= re sufficient registers. > Isn't it enough to rely on the existing Camellia and AES code? The problem is that you have to do *two* crypto operations - and that it m= ay not be possible to parallellise them. With AES+SHA1 and Camellia, they ca= n be parallellised as both sides work on the plaintext; but with the AES+SHA2, = the encryption is done and then the *encrypted* output is checksummed. Note that "parallellising" might mean launching an async hash request and = an async skcipher request and then waiting for both to finish. This can't, however, be done unless the output buffer is separate from the input buffe= r. > Mentioning 'something like the Intel QAT' doesn't suggest you have somet= hing > specific in mind. I have an Intel QAT card, and under some circumstances I could offload the crypto to it... But the only operations the driver currently makes availa= ble are: authenc(hmac(sha1),cbc(aes)) authenc(hmac(sha256),cbc(aes)) authenc(hmac(sha512),cbc(aes)) The first one can't be used for kerberos's aes128-cts-hmac-sha1-96 as it hashes the ciphertext, not the plain text. I don't have anything that use= s the third. The second is a possibility. I think that could probably do aes128-cts-hmac-sha256-128. Now, it's possible that the QAT device range can do more than the driver offers. I'm presuming that the driver offers what IPsec wants to support.
